Career Progression
John's career trajectory showcases his progression from financial analysis to executive leadership. Prior to his current role, he served as SR. Business Director and Director of Financial Planning & Reporting at The MENTOR Network. Earlier in his career, he worked as a Financial Analyst at Harvard University - UIS and an Account Analyst at Fidelity, laying the foundation for his future success.
